Council Regulation (EC) No 974/98 of 3 May 1998 on the introduction of the euro

Amended by73:

- Council Regulation (EC) No 2596/2000 of 27 November 2000 74

- Council Regulation (EC) No 2169/2005 of 21 December 200575

- Council Regulation (EC) No 1647/2006 of 7 November 2006 76

[No 974/98 of 3 May 1998]

THE COUNCIL OF THE EUROPEAN UNION, Having regard to the Treaty establishing the European Community, and in particular Article 1091(4), third sentence thereof,

Having regard to the proposal from the Commission 77,

Having regard to the opinion of the European Monetary Institute 78,

Having regard to the opinion of the European Parliament 79,

(1) Whereas this Regulation denes monetary law provisions of the Mem ber States which have adopted the euro; whereas provisions on continuity of contracts, the replacement of references to the ecu in legal instruments by references to the euro and rounding have already been laid down in Council Regulation (EC) No 1103/97 of 17 June 1997 on certain provisions relating to the introduction of the euro 80; whereas the introduction of the euro concerns day-to-day operations of the whole population in participating Member States; whereas measures other than those in this Regulation and in Regulation (EC) No 1103/97 should be examined to ensure a balanced changeover, in particular for consumers;...
